Savage Messiah (2002)

He promised them... Love, Healing, SALVATION

Savage Messiah (2002) poster

As a small-town social worker investigates a commune headed by a spiritual leader calling himself Moses, she discovers a dead child, sadistic rituals, and ruthless mental and physical abuse.

Director: Mario Philip Azzopardi
Genre: Drama, Thriller
Runtime: 94 min

Music: Frank Ilfman
Cinematography: Serge Ladouceur
Editing: Mike Lee
Production: Astral Films, Bernard Zukerman Productions, Corus Entertainment
Country: Canada, United Kingdom
Language: English, Français
